Understanding Vacations for Seniors with Mobility Issues
Vacations for seniors with mobility issues are designed to provide enjoyable and accessible travel experiences for older adults who may face challenges in mobility. These vacations take into account the specific needs of seniors, ensuring that they can explore new destinations without the stress of navigating difficult terrains or inaccessible facilities. From transportation options to accommodations, every aspect is tailored to enhance comfort and convenience.
Accessible Destinations
When planning vacations for seniors with mobility issues, choosing accessible destinations is crucial. Many cities and tourist spots now prioritize accessibility, offering wheelchair-friendly attractions, ramps, and elevators. Popular destinations include beach resorts with boardwalks, urban areas with public transport that accommodates wheelchairs, and national parks that provide accessible trails. Researching these locations can help ensure a smooth and enjoyable experience.
Transportation Options
Transportation plays a vital role in vacations for seniors with mobility issues. Many travel companies offer specialized transportation services that cater to seniors, including shuttle services with wheelchair access and vehicles equipped with lifts. Additionally, some airlines provide assistance at airports, ensuring that seniors can navigate through terminals with ease. It’s essential to communicate specific needs when booking travel to ensure all arrangements are in place.
Accommodations for Comfort
Choosing the right accommodations is essential for vacations for seniors with mobility issues. Look for hotels or resorts that offer accessible rooms, which typically include features such as grab bars, roll-in showers, and wider doorways. Many establishments also provide amenities like elevators and on-site dining options that are easy to access. Booking a room in advance can help secure the best accommodations tailored to mobility needs.
Activities and Excursions
Engaging in activities is a key part of vacations for seniors with mobility issues. Many tour operators now offer excursions specifically designed for seniors, featuring gentle walks, scenic drives, and cultural experiences that are easy to navigate. Options like guided tours with accessible transportation allow seniors to enjoy sightseeing without the physical strain. Always check the accessibility of activities beforehand to ensure a comfortable experience.
Health and Safety Considerations
Health and safety are paramount during vacations for seniors with mobility issues. It’s advisable for seniors to consult with their healthcare providers before traveling, especially if they have pre-existing conditions. Carrying necessary medications, having a list of local medical facilities, and ensuring travel insurance covers health-related issues can provide peace of mind. Staying hydrated and taking breaks during activities can also help maintain energy levels.
Travel Insurance for Seniors
Travel insurance is an important aspect of vacations for seniors with mobility issues. It can cover unexpected events such as trip cancellations, medical emergencies, or lost belongings. Seniors should look for insurance plans that specifically cater to their needs, including coverage for pre-existing conditions. Understanding the policy details and ensuring adequate coverage can help mitigate risks associated with travel.
Supportive Travel Companions
Having supportive travel companions can significantly enhance vacations for seniors with mobility issues. Whether it’s family members, friends, or caregivers, having someone to assist with mobility challenges can make a world of difference. Companions can help navigate unfamiliar environments, provide emotional support, and ensure that seniors can participate in activities comfortably and safely.
Planning Ahead for a Smooth Experience
Planning ahead is essential for successful vacations for seniors with mobility issues. This includes researching accessible destinations, booking accommodations and transportation in advance, and creating an itinerary that allows for flexibility. By anticipating potential challenges and making necessary arrangements, seniors can enjoy a stress-free vacation that caters to their mobility needs.
